maine: Taking Snow And Snowe For Granted In Maine - 03/02/12 12:17 AM
For a long time, Mainers have always counted on 2 things, snow and Snowe.  What an interesting year this has turned out to be.
Our snow deficit was helped somewhat yesterday with a Noreaster that blew through and finally gave us a measurable amount of snow.  This is good or bad depending on your perspective.
Then this week, we received the announcement that our long standing Senator, Olympia Snowe would not seek re-election.  This was definitely a surprise to almost everyone and has both political parties scrambling for candidates.

maine: We're Having A Heatwave! - 11/30/11 03:27 AM
Mainers woke up to the very strange news that Bangor Maine had the highest temperature in the lower 48 this morning.  In fact, it seems that this November may have been the warmest on record for us.
Not earth shattering news, just an odd feeling for us up here.  In Auburn Maine today, the sun has made an appearance and we woke up to 54 degrees and the last remnants of our 14 inches of snow melted away.  We're not complaining.  I must admit it has been nice to have a bit more time to prepare for winter.

maine: Runaround Pond Durham Maine: A Little Slice of Heaven - 10/03/10 09:00 AM
I had some time to putter around between showings today, so I decided to get lost accidentally on purpose in Durham Maine.  As I poked along Rabbit Road, I happened upon a small empty park labeled "Runaround Pond Recreation Area."  A tranquil little spot with a few picnic tables alongside Durham's Runaround pond.  All alone on this sunny and crisp fall day, I simply sat down on a large expanse of rock and soaked in the atmosphere while listening to the birds and critters.
